What can I see and do near Newark Street Dog Park?
You'll want to browse the collections at Smithsonian Institution, Hillwood Estate, Museum & Gardens, and Phillips Collection. Explore notable local landmarks like White House, Anderson House Museum, and Mansion on O Street. You can catch a show at Lincoln Theater, Kennedy Center, and George Washington Lisner Auditorium.
How can I get to Newark Street Dog Park?
You can walk to nearby metro stations including Cleveland Park Station, Van Ness-UDC Station, and Woodley Park-Zoo Station. If you'd like to venture around the surrounding area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
